What is the Lease Subordination Agreement New Jersey
The Lease Subordination Agreement in New Jersey is a legal document that establishes the relationship between a leaseholder and a lender. This agreement allows a lender to take precedence over the leaseholder's rights in the event of foreclosure or other legal actions. Essentially, it ensures that the lender's interest in the property is prioritized, which is crucial when the property is subject to a mortgage. This agreement is particularly important in commercial real estate transactions, where the stability of the lease is vital for both the landlord and the lender.
Key elements of the Lease Subordination Agreement New Jersey
Several key elements define the Lease Subordination Agreement in New Jersey. These include:
- Identification of Parties: The agreement must clearly identify the landlord, tenant, and lender involved.
- Description of the Property: A detailed description of the property subject to the lease must be included.
- Subordination Clause: This clause specifies that the lease is subordinate to the mortgage, meaning the lender's rights take precedence.
- Rights and Obligations: The agreement outlines the rights and responsibilities of each party, including any conditions for default or termination.
- Governing Law: It should state that New Jersey law governs the agreement, ensuring compliance with state regulations.
Steps to complete the Lease Subordination Agreement New Jersey
Completing the Lease Subordination Agreement in New Jersey involves several important steps:
- Gather Information: Collect all necessary information about the parties involved, the property, and any existing leases.
- Draft the Agreement: Use a template or legal guidance to draft the agreement, ensuring all key elements are included.
- Review the Document: Have all parties review the agreement to confirm accuracy and understanding.
- Sign the Agreement: All parties must sign the document. Electronic signatures are valid in New Jersey, provided they meet legal requirements.
- File the Agreement: Depending on the circumstances, it may be necessary to file the agreement with local authorities or provide copies to relevant parties.
Legal use of the Lease Subordination Agreement New Jersey
The legal use of the Lease Subordination Agreement in New Jersey is governed by state law, which recognizes the enforceability of such agreements. For the document to be legally binding, it must comply with the New Jersey Statutes and relevant regulations. This includes ensuring that all parties have the legal capacity to enter into the agreement and that the terms are clear and unambiguous. Additionally, the agreement must be executed in accordance with the law, which may include notarization or other formalities.

State-specific rules for the Lease Subordination Agreement New Jersey
New Jersey has specific rules regarding Lease Subordination Agreements that must be followed to ensure enforceability. These include:
- Written Agreement: The agreement must be in writing to be enforceable.
- Signatures: All parties must sign the agreement, and electronic signatures are permissible under New Jersey law.
- Compliance with Local Laws: The agreement must comply with any local ordinances or regulations that may apply to real estate transactions.
